MEMO — Welcome aboard! As you've probably heard, we're wrapping up the sale of the Glintware accessories unit to Parvold Group. Most of the Tellbrook team transfers over in Q3, and the remaining staff fold into operations under Mira Askett. It's been smoother than expected, honestly. Before your first leadership sync, please review the note below on where we go next.

board note of kagep-yahig: Only 9 of the 120 pilot accounts renewed Quenix, so a churn review is set for April 1.

Handover — Lease Renegotiation, Fennick Quay Site

For the board: negotiations with landlord Ashvale Holdings are at round three. We secured a 12% reduction proposal on the Fennick Quay premises, contingent on a seven-year term. Break clause at year four still disputed. Counsel from Merriden Law advises accepting with a rent-review cap. Incoming director takes over from the next session; files are in the shared deal room. The board's confidential position on terms is noted below.

board note of kageg-bahof: The renewal with Holwynax Holdings closes at $2 million a year, 5 percent below the last contract. Project Ulaath slips by two quarters because of the supplier delay.

Handover: Lundqvist Catalogue Import

Taking over from me is Priya's team; this note is for the security review. The importer pulls MARC records from the Fennwick Library consortium nightly, normalizes them, and writes to the catalogue store. Credentials were rotated last month after the Bramley audit. No PII flows through this path — records are bibliographic only. Retry and throttling behaviour is all config-driven. For the review, the current production configuration is reproduced below.

deployment values, kajep-kageg:
[praix]
host = praix.paliqcorp.corp
user = praix_svc
database = praix_prod

Subject: Partner SFTP drop — new owner

Hi,

As you review the pending changes to the Harborline ingest scripts, note that ownership of the partner SFTP drop is changing at the end of the month. This includes key rotation, the nightly pull job, and the quarantine folder for malformed files. Review comments on the retry logic should still go through the normal PR flow, but questions about drop-folder conventions or partner onboarding now go to the new owner. The incoming owner is listed below.

signatory, tagaf-bahaf: Praael Fenmir Rusok